Founded in 1973, dm is a cultural touchstone in Germany. Germans consistently vote dm as their favorite seller. The stores are carefully organized, wheelchair- and stroller-friendly, and lit with warm, welcoming lighting. dm is especially popular for pioneering the "personal label" transformation in Germany, offering premium-quality cosmetics and skincare at a portion of the cost of name brands.
2. Dirk Rossmann GmbH (Rossmann)
As the second-largest chain, Rossmann is common throughout German towns and cities. Rossmann is known for aggressive discounting, weekly coupon books, Medikamenten-Drogerie Deutschland and a wonderful digital app. While its store layout can in some cases feel slightly more practical than dm, its product variety is equally remarkable.
3. Müller
Müller differ since it operates nearly like a mini-department store. While it has the very same extensive pharmacy and natural food areas as dm and Rossmann, a normal Müller will likewise feature a massive toy department, a stationery and book section, and a high-end luxury fragrance counter.

The Magic of German Drugstore House Brands (Eigenmarken)
Among the greatest tricks of the German pharmacy is the quality of its private-label brands. In lots of nations, store-brand items are considered as inexpensive, inferior alternatives to call brand names. In Germany, the opposite is typically true.
German consumer magazines (like Stiftung Warentest) regularly test pharmacy house brand names against luxury brand UnterstüTzung Beim Abnehmen Deutschland names, and Eigenmarken regularly win top honors for quality, ingredient security, and value.
